摘要
The research has as the objective to study the strategies and social networks used by informal workers in misfortune situations. We interviewed sixteen workers of the buildings' construction sector of Sao Carlos (Sao Paulo, Brazil). We tried to understand how they deal with working capacity reduction inside a precariousness context and how they perceive these situations. The qualitative analysis shows that most of them have financial difficulties to acquire private forms of protection. We could infer that informal social networks are essential for them deal to periods of working incapacity. Moreover the nuclear and extended family supports and religious networks are predominating.
